Neurological Rehabilitation in Atlanta
Neurological conditions require specialized care. Stroke, traumatic brain injury, vestibular disorders, and other neurological diagnoses can affect balance, coordination, strength, and mobility. That’s why our neurological rehabilitation services in Atlanta, GA, focus on retraining the nervous system through repetition, task-specific practice, and progressive challenge. Balance training is particularly important. Conditions that cause balance problems may involve the inner ear, central nervous system, or sensory integration deficits.

FAQs About Neurological Physical Therapy in Atlanta
How long does neurological physical therapy usually last?
Recovery timelines vary depending on the condition, severity of symptoms, and patient goals. Some patients attend therapy for a few weeks, while others benefit from longer-term neurological rehabilitation programs focused on mobility, balance, and daily function.
What conditions are commonly treated with neurological rehabilitation?
Neurological physical therapy may help individuals recovering from stroke, traumatic brain injury, Parkinson’s disease, multiple sclerosis, vestibular disorders, neuropathy, and other conditions affecting balance, coordination, and movement.
Can neurological physical therapy help with dizziness or vertigo?
Yes. Vestibular rehabilitation is often included as part of neurological physical therapy for patients experiencing dizziness, balance problems, or vertigo related to the inner ear or nervous system.

What happens during a neurological physical therapy evaluation?
Initial evaluations often include assessments for balance, gait, coordination, mobility, strength, and fall risk. Therapists also review medical history, symptoms, and functional goals to develop a personalized rehabilitation plan.
